The Art of Mindful Eating: Nourishing Your Body and Mind with Healthy Meals

In a world filled with hectic schedules, fast food options, and constant distractions, the practice of mindful eating has emerged as a powerful tool for promoting overall well-being. Mindful eating is not just about what we eat but also how we eat, focusing on the present moment, and cultivating a deeper connection with our food, body, and mind. Let’s delve into the art of mindful eating and explore how it can transform your relationship with food and enhance your health and vitality.

**1. Eating with Awareness**

Mindful eating begins with eating with awareness, which means being fully present and conscious during meals. It involves slowing down, savoring each bite, and paying attention to the flavors, textures, and sensations of the food. By eating with awareness, we can better appreciate the nourishment and pleasure that food provides, leading to a more satisfying and enjoyable eating experience.

**2. Honoring Hunger and Fullness**

Mindful eating encourages us to listen to our body’s hunger and fullness cues. This means eating when we are truly hungry and stopping when we are comfortably full, rather than eating out of habit, emotion, or external cues. Honoring hunger and fullness helps us develop a more intuitive and balanced approach to eating, allowing us to maintain a healthy weight and prevent overeating.

**3. Engaging the Senses**

Engaging the senses is a key aspect of mindful eating. This involves using all our senses—sight, smell, taste, touch, and even sound—to fully experience and enjoy our meals.
